The Story Behind Clancy
Clancy is an anglicized form of the Irish surname Mac Fhlannchaidh, meaning 'son of Flannchadh'. The personal name Flannchadh is derived from the Old Irish elements 'flann' (meaning 'red' or 'blood-red') and 'cath' (meaning 'battle' or 'warrior'). Therefore, the name literally translates to 'red warrior' or 'son of the red warrior'.
The name originated in County Leitrim and County Roscommon in Ireland, where the Mac Fhlannchaidh clan was prominent. Over time, as Irish surnames were anglicized, Mac Fhlannchaidh became Clancy. While historically a surname, Clancy has been adopted as a given name, particularly in English-speaking countries, for both boys and girls, though it leans slightly more masculine.
